Mobile Computer Centre inaugurated
Source: The Sangai Express
Imphal, December 08 2014:
A Mobile Computer Centre was today inaugurated by National Institute of Electronics and Information Technology (NIELIT) Imphal Centre in collaboration with Ragailong Youth Club (RYC) at Ragailong, Imphal East.
The Mobile Computer Centre would offer six months courses in Diploma in computer application, network administration, soft skill and two months certificate course in computer concept.
The inaugural function was attended by Minlianthang Vaiphei, Director, TA and Hills and Th Premeshwor Singh, Director, NIELET, Imphal as the chief guest and guest of honour respectively.
Chief guest Minlianthang said that use of e-governance is on the rise in the country and to acquaint onself with various applications of computer is a must.
He further conveyed his hope that the courses would be constructive for both young and old alike.

Th Premeshwor, Director, NIELIT, Imphal elaborated on the priviledges offered by NIELIT and the importance of digital literacy in today's advancing society.
He further expressed his desire to organise an awareness programme on cyber crime in the locality particularly for youngsters.
President of the function Ragailong Khullakpa David Kamei exuded confidence that the courses would yield positive impact to the students.
